Love the hosts, hate the phone calls after games
I love the show for what it’s good at. Coverage of the Lions. They are passionate but fair when they critique the team, which is always important. They are my favorite Detroit Lions podcast because they are the most knowledgeable. My only complaint is the “live” post game shows. I don’t like to listen drunk morons at any point, but especially after a football game. I usually just avoid those shows. Overall, if you are a tortured lions fan, and would like some more coverage, this show is for you. Enjoy
